You may remember that one of the challenges at last year's final was to design a contemporary arts centre for Plymouth's Millbay area. This challenge was set by local architects Bailey Partnership. Part of the reward for the team who produced the best design was to see a professional mock-up of the building done by Bailey using the software they themselves use.
